摘    要:矿井涌水是一种在矿井开挖过程中从岩层中涌出的地下水。以往对矿井涌水的利用仅限于对水源本身的使用,深井HEMS降温系统首次将矿井涌水作为其系统的冷源使用。本文以夹河矿和三河尖矿为例,阐述在深井HEMS降温系统运行过程中矿井涌水的冷却问题。实际应用表明,高差循环降温技术和水平循环降温技术均可将作为冷源的矿井涌水水温控制在25~30℃,保证了深井HEMS降温系统的正常运行。

Abstract:Mine water is a kind of ground water which gushes from the rocks during excavation.In the past,mine water is limited to the use of water sources itself.HEMS cooling system uses mine water as its cold sources for the first time.Taking Jiahe coal mine and Sanhejian coal mine as examples in this paper,the cooling of mine water is illustrated during the running of HEMS cooling system in deep mine.Practical appalication shows that the temperature of mine water which is used as cold sources could be controlled in...
